Wadebridge railway station
Wadebridge railway station was on the Bodmin and Wadebridge Railway. It opened in 1834 to transport goods between the market town of Wadebridge, the limit of navigation on the River Camel, and inland farming and mining areas. Now it is a free exhibition in the old railway station, refreshments also available.

Bodmin Jail
Bodmin Jail is an historic former prison situated in Bodmin. Built in 1779 and closed in 1927, the large range of buildings is now largely in ruins, although parts of the prison have been turned into a tourist attraction.

0.00km - With back to Harbour Office go LEFT through two car parks with estuary on left and past Stein Fisheries and 2 cycle hire shops to find the start of the Camel Trail. Now follow this clear cycle path all the way to the outskirts of Wadebridge by Lidl supermarkets.
9.00km - STRAIGHT AHEAD and in 250m ahead again, in 200m LEFT and follow road round passing John Betjeman Centre (which is the old station). At the end of this road continue along Camel Trail (all well signed). Reach café.
16.60km - STRAIGHT AHEAD, trail crosses two roads and passes Boscarne Junction, one end of the Bodmin & Wenford Railway. Enter park on outskirts of Bodmin to reach road.
19.40km - RIGHT along and follow NCR3 to church and town centre.
20.80km - Finish at the church.
